摘要
The method of creating the machine model with respect to all operating points of the machine preferably uses neural networks. The control parameter is dependent on a set of input parameters esp. system parameters, system parameters differentiated over time, time delayed fed-back output parameters and/or predetermined values at the desired operating point. The control parameters for a sub-set of operating points are determined using measurement technology. Using a simplified partial model, one output parameter per model function is determined. At each desired operating point, the output parameters of each partial model function are weighted with a suitable weighting function and are combined to a total output parameter for that point. For all points, the difference between the total output parameter and the control parameter determined by measuring is determined. For operating points where this difference exceeds a predetermined value, a different model function or a different weighting function is used to bring the difference to a value below the predetermined value. The step of determining the difference and the step of using a different model function or weighting function are carried out as often as required for the statistically determined prediction quality of the entire model to reach the desired value.
